BOILEAU, City Attorney City Commission Regular Meeting Agenda October 6, 2020 In an effort to encourage people to stay at home, limit public gatherings, and slow the spread of the coronavirus, Florida Governor Ron DeSantis waived state requirements for local governments to have in-person quorums for public meetings as part of Executive Order 20-69. The City of Fort Lauderdale will be hosting virtual Commission Meetings using audio/video conferencing software until further notice. The public will be able to listen to and view the virtual meeting at www.fortlauderdale.gov/fltv, www.youtube.com/cityoffortlauderdale, as well as Comcast Channel 78 and AT&T U-verse Channel 99.
